Our team, the Command and Control, Battle Management and Communications (C2BMC) team at Lockheed Martin, is dedicated to engineering, developing, and integrating new capabilities for the Missile Defense System that protects the United States and its allies. While we are part of a large organization, we operate within smaller, agile teams in a fast-paced, dynamic environment. Our responsibilities include Sensor/Weapon Integration, Algorithm Development, User Interface Development, Automated Testing, Cyber Security, and enhancing critical missile defense technologies. The Work The Interface Engineer will lead in authoring and designing Interface Control Documents (ICDs) and Interface Design Documents (IDDs). This includes establishing new interfaces between external elements, including sensors, and other Command and Control Systems. The Interface Engineer will ensure the ICDs and IDDs created are to appropriate standards required of the program. Additionally, it is expected that the Interface Engineer develop various behavioral diagrams to understand and document the requirements. The Interface Engineer's primary responsibility will be developing, updating, and maintaining multiple ICDs and IDDs. Successful candidate will attend interface working group meetings with the external MDA customer and representatives of assigned external element engineering organization as well as support to program integration and test related efforts for the associated interface. Successful candidate may also be assigned to support: other Interface Engineers in developing ICDs for other Missile Defense Systems Elements, support requirements engineering, use case development, and logical architecture modeling tasks as SE department tasking requires. The Interface Engineer will support leadership (internal and external), developers, and testers with messages and interface rules (transmit, receive, processing) questions and test findings.
